The Zhitong Finance App learned that Ganfeng Lithium (01772) rose by more than 5%. As of press release, it had risen 5.38% to HK$26.45, with a turnover of HK$41.0853 million.
According to the news, the Zhiji L6 was announced on April 8. The car was the first to be equipped with the industry's first mass-produced “ultra-fast charging solid state battery 1.0”. It uses ultra-high ionic conductivity composite solid electrolytes and integrated molding process technology with dry solid electrolytes, breaking through a long battery life of 1,000 kilometers.
Guohai Securities said that in recent years, solid-state batteries from many companies have continued to advance in terms of performance improvement and mass production progress, which is expected to accelerate the industrialization process of solid-state batteries. The inflection point for semi-solid-state batteries has reached. All-solid-state batteries are expected to be fully commercialized in 2030. According to reports, in the investor relations activity records disclosed by Ganfeng Lithium on March 29 this year, it was mentioned that the first phase of the company's solid state battery production base in Chongqing was capped, and solid state battery packs were delivered.
